Oluyomi's obituary
Evangelist Oluyomi M. Odumosu, a devoted wife, mother, grandmother, and humble servant of God of 43 years of a blessed marriage. She is survived by her loving husband, Apostle E. Ayoolu Odumosu, their three children, Tomiwa (Laretha), Dunni (Mtokufa), Niyi, two cherished grandchildren AyoMosiah & Simisola, and a massive extended family all over the world.
She was born in the year of our Lord 1957 in Lagos, Nigeria, resided at Bear, DE, and passed on to glory on Sunday, August 25, 2024
Oluyomi led a life of unwavering service, touching countless lives across multiple continents and countries. Her faith in Christ was the cornerstone of her existence, guiding her every action as a devout Christian and humble servant of God. Her legacy of love, compassion, and dedication to others will continue to inspire all who knew her.

Professional Accomplishments:
For a period of over fifteen years, Oluyomi worked at the City of Trenton municipality and managed city wide recreational, multiple state and federal grant administration in tune of over Five million dollars on a yearly basis effectively and efficiently and retired as a stella government employee in the year 2007.
After her retirement, she engaged on another career as an accounting consultant with BNY Mellon of New York/Delaware for a period of Five years while she oversaw various financial portfolios for the C-Suites office. After fulfilling her contractual obligations with BNY Mellon, Oluyomi decided to pursue her long time passion of working the Children and minors.
For her last professional career Starting in 2014 to 2022 a period of eight years, Oluyomi founded a My Little Adventures, LLC provided a professional service for nursing mothers, Children and Children’s play party activities that help support family t5o provide a fun activities and fun memories.
While busy with her professional career she also supports her husband Apostle Ayoolu Odumosu in his ministries and occupied the position of the First lady.
